IRVINE, California, August 1. TODAY’S preliminary competition at the USA Swimming junior nationals will feature some of the nation’s top teenagers battling for spots in one of the eight lanes for the championship final, or several spots available for the B and C finals.

Today’s events include the women’s and men’s 400 freestyle, as well as the women’s and men’s 100 butterfly.

Sierra Schmidt, the winner of the women’s 800 free, will be looking for the distance double tonight. Townley Haas will show off his diversity one day after winning the 100 free final, aiming for a 400 free victory today.

How many ladies will break the 1:00 barrier in the 100 fly prelims? Michelle Cefal is the only swimmer seeded in the 59-second range with a 59.13, but she could bring along a few others in the race for spots in the final. The men’s 100 fly final will feature a great battle, with Justin Lynch’s meet record of 52.91 on the line.
